Benefits

High thermal efficiency due to evaporation from the wet section

More cooling density per sq ft than dry coolers

Uses less water than wet cooling towers

Flexible performance across all seasons

Reduced plume visibility compared to wet cooling towers

A hybrid cooling tower combines features of wet (evaporative) and dry (air cooled) cooling technologies in a single piece of equipment. Its purpose is to reduce water consumption, visible plume, and environmental impact while maintaining heat rejection performance close to that of a conventional wet cooling tower.

Minimum Approach Temperature:

Cold Water Temperature > 5 Degrees Above Design Wet bulb Temperature – Wet Section

Cold Water Temperature > 10 Degrees Above Design Dry bulb Temperature – Dry Section
